Last May saw the first edition of Indie Assemble, an international Steam promotion organized by Excaliber to celebrate indie video games, which recorded extraordinary numbers: 600 participating developers and publishers from 63 countries with over 1,200 games, more than 3.3 million impressions, and 100,000 unique views. After such success, Excaliber decided to further strengthen its commitment to supporting the independent video game industry and today launches a new promotion, an even more focused spin-off: The 123 Stars, available at this link.
This time, the spotlight is on “only” 123 indie video games – stars shining brighter than all the others in a firmament that counted a total of 1,234 submissions from every corner of the globe. The participants were selected by an international jury of experts composed of leading figures in the video game industry. Their names:

The 123 Stars officially kicks off today, September 1, at 7:00 PM CET / 10:00 AM PST, and will run until Sunday, September 7, at the same time. A week of celebrations with great discounts on already released titles and a showcase of upcoming indie games.

During the selection, the Jury awarded the special Jury Choice, recognizing the video game that stood out the most for its ability to represent the importance of the medium and the artistic value video games can achieve. The award went to As Long As You’re Here, an intense narrative experience that explores the life of Annie, an elderly woman with Alzheimer’s. As Long As You’re Here addresses with great delicacy and depth a topic of pressing relevance, especially considering that the World Health Organization estimates that over 57 million people worldwide live with dementia, with nearly 10 million new cases each year. This work not only moved the Jury but also brings an important narrative to the forefront, demonstrating how video games can convey emotions and sensations that other media cannot.
